SUCCESS, n. The Sc. pronunciation [′sʌksɛs] is still freq. heard and is attested from the 18th c. (Sc. 1722 Ramsay Poems (S.T.S.) III. 23, 1764 Scots Mag. (April) 187, 1779 A. Scot Contrast 13).
